Itinerary
DAY 1 LISBON
Booking into the 3* hotel in Lisbon. Dinner. Free evening.
DAY 2 LISBON
Breakfast in the hotel. In the morning, guided tour of Lisbon. Lunch. In the afternoon, a panoramic tour of Lisbon by coach. Nicknamed “The City of Lights ”, explore it through the Sao Jorge castle, surrounded by the medieval quarters of Alfama and Mouraria. Back to the hotel for dinner and accommodation. Free evening.
DAY 3 LISBON - COIMBRA - PORTO
Breakfast in the hotel. Departure by coach for Coimbra. Lunch. In the afternoon, your guide will show you around this charming city lapped by the waters of the Mandego with its confusion of narrow, picturesque streets, its cathedral, built in 1598, which offers a careful melange of Byzantine capitals, Gothic altarpieces and Renaissance chapels. Departure by coach for Porto. Boarding from 5:00 pm. Settling in your cabins. Our staff will introduce itself, and you will be served a welcome cocktail followed by your first dinner aboard. In the evening, optional visit of the illuminated Porto by coach.
DAY 4 PORTO - REGUA
After a buffet breakfast aboard, we will discover Porto (optional excursion) , Portugal ’s second largest town, as well as one of the most ancient towns in Europe : ancient areas which are kept intact, winding lanes , houses with archways,magnificent churches… Porto also represents the port wine with its vineyards along the Douro . We are going to visit one of the greatest cellars in Villa Nova de Gaia . You will have the opportunity to taste the wines. Then, we will go back to the ship to have lunch, start the cruise and admire the wonderful landscapes up to Regua . We will pass the locks of Crestuma and Carapatello (the highest in Europe : 35 meters). Arrival in Regua around 8:00 pm. Dinner aboard and evening with a folk group or walk by night in Regua.
DAY 5 REGUA - VEGA DE TERON Buffet breakfast aboard followed by the visit of Vila Real . Later on, we will leave for the most lovely walk (optional excursion) in the beautiful gardens of Solar de Mateus, and join the ship for lunch in Pinhao . For the others, the ship will start the cruise to Pinhao, where we will have lunch aboard.We are then going to cruise through the wonderful high hills, in the very heart of the most famous Porto vineyards, planted in stairs, up to 700 meters high.We will go through the lock of Valeria and will arrive in Vega de Teron in the evening. Dinner and “Spanish” themed evening.
DAY 6 VEGA DE TERON (excursion to Salamanca ) Breakfast on board. Departure for the optional excursion of Salamanca. This town is UNESCO World heritage site with its Roman, Arabic and Christian architectural treasures. Lunch in Salamanca . Back on board at Vega de Teron. Dinner and farewell evening.
DAY 7 VEGA DE TERON - PINHAO - REGUA - BITETOS Early cruise departure from Vega de Teron. Breakfast on board. While sailing, you will enjoy the wild landscapes. Lunch on board. We will reach Pinhao around 2:00 pm . Departure by coach for an optional visit of Lamego, during which you will discover the Nossa Senhora Dos Remedios sanctuary, the medieval castle, the church of Almacave and the Cathedral. The boat will sail towards Regua, where we will join it around 5:00 pm. Continuation of the cruise towards Bitetos. Dinner and traditional evening on board.
DAY 8 BITETOS - PORTO
Early in the morning, departure on cruise towards Porto. Lunch aboard. Disembarkation. End of our services.
